That is very neatly cut out. How did you do it?

Wouldn't trust the nephew, he looks angry with the eyes...

Poster Thread
dattodude
Posted: 2003/3/3 6:14  Updated: 2003/3/3 6:14
No life (a.k.a. DattoMaster)
Joined: 1998/12/6
From: Sydney, Australia
Posts: 5806
 Re: Nephew Lachlan and my CA18DET
I used a spare hour, a can of VB, Photoshop 7.0 and a bit of patience.

I cut out the original on my laptop using the touchpad pointer (smoother than a mouse), I used the lasso tool. I then cut and pasted that to a new document. I used the eraser to clean up the edges. Then bucket-filled the background.
